As the Director of Technology Product and Program Management, you will lead, mentor and coach our product and program management team.

You will be the beacon of technology productizing principles and working with our teams to deliver world class cloud solutions.

This role is primarily focused on internal solutions for our business partners with emphasis vision, roadmap, design, and business process delivery through iterative release.

We believe in being a cloud first organization, leveraging cloud-native best practices, microservices, open source and SaaS solutions.

For you to be successful, we believe experience in the following skills is required :

  • Experience in mentoring, leading and coaching all levels of product managers, UX designers, project managers and scrum masters
  • Experience managing both onshore and offshore acceptance criteria
  • Supported, cultivated and guided career growth progressions
  • Championed and implemented product management best practices
  • Experience delivering enterprise applications with high quality and market adoption
  • Experience in business modeling, planning, and strategy development
  • Experience driving alignment to common team and individual goals
  • Created technical alignment to deliver strategic business initiatives
  • Exceptional business acumen and presence in front of customers and business executives
  • Working Experience (7+ years)
  • Leading and managing internal and external teams
  • Delivering custom solutions with high customer satisfaction and market adoption
  • Building highly trusted and collaborative relationships with Product Engineering
